Pinpoint Weather: Warm Tuesday, rain returns


ROANOKE, Va. (WFXR) — Temperatures will remain warm on Tuesday as the region sits ahead of a cold front. Temperatures will start the day in the 40s before rising into the 50s and 60s during the afternoon.

Showers look to return on Tuesday with steady rain forming late in the afternoon or during the early evening hours, continuing into Wednesday.

Much needed rainfall is expected with one to inches expected before this system moves east later in the day on Wednesday.

If the cold air can move in before the rain moves out, we could see the rain changing to snow. Most of the accumulation will stay on the western slopes of the mountains, but a dusting to a half inch is possible in spots eastward to the Blue Ridge. Higher accumulations are expected at the mountaintops with lower in the valleys.

Behind the front, windy conditions will develop for Wednesday and Thursday with gusts to 40 mph possible.

Temperatures will then turn cold for the end of the week and weekend, with highs in the 30s and 40s.
